Transaction 43a84d43f1decf853ac1c4fc643af7db5a78b34ccb8b6015d9f7f48d6368e795

3 Input
2 Outputs
  • 43a84d43f1decf853ac1c4fc643af7db5a78b34ccb8b6015d9f7f48d6368e795:0
  • value  201003005
    address  1FbhmjxX5XX6439y2kPHFbTvgyZmY9mrMi
  • 43a84d43f1decf853ac1c4fc643af7db5a78b34ccb8b6015d9f7f48d6368e795:1
  • value  75933139
    address  31qneokFGwpEkoZRksjymxZAiTEmAim3Ab